右旋美托咪啶在小儿全麻苏醒期躁动防治中的应用
Application of Dexmedetomidine on emergence agitation in children After general anesthesia

关键词:
右旋美托咪啶;苏醒期躁动;丙泊酚;儿童
dexmedetomidine; emergence agitation; propofol; children
摘要:
目的 评价右旋美托咪啶(dexmedetomidine, Dex)在小儿全麻苏醒期躁动防治中的应用。方法 120例择期骨科手术患儿,随机分为四组,每组30例:A组(Dex 0.4μg/kg+0.9%Nacl至10ml)、B组(Dex 0.2μg/kg+0.9%Nacl至10ml)、C组(丙泊酚1mg/kg)与D组(生理盐水10ml)。A组、B组和D组于手术结束前10min分别静脉泵注完成;C组手术结束后静脉注射。小儿苏醒期躁动(emergence agitation EA)评分采用Aono的四分评级法与PAED(儿童麻醉苏醒谵妄评分)法,记录拔管后15min时的EA与PAED评分及躁动发生率。结果 拔管后15min时,A组与B组、C组和D组比较,EA评分与PAED评分显著下降(P<0.05); A组术后躁动发生率也显著低于B组、C组和D组。结论 手术结束前10分钟静脉输注Dex0.4μg/Kg/10min,能降低小儿苏醒期的躁动率。
Objective To evaluate the effect of Dexmedetomidine (Dex) on emergence agitation in children after general anesthesia. Methods 120 pediatric patients undergoing elective orthopedic operation were randomly divided to four groups (each n = 30): group A (Dex 0.4μg/kg+0.9%Nacl to 10ml), group B (Dex0.2μg/kg+0.9%Nacl to 10ml), group C (propofol 1mg/kg) and group D(saline 10ml). 10 min before the end of operation, group A, group B and group D were continuously administrated by injection pump within 10 min respectively. Group C was administrated after the end of operation. Aono four point rating method and Pediatric anesthesia emergence delirium scale (PAED) methods were used for scoring the children emergence agitation (EA), recorded EA, PAED scores and the incidence of agitation after extubation. Results EA and PAED scores are significantly decreased in group A compared with which in group B, groupC and group D (P<0.05). There is no significant difference between group B, group C and group D (P>0.05).The incidence of agitation of group A is decreased respectively compared with group B、group C and group D. Conclusion 10 min before the end of operation, administration with Dex 0.4μg/kg/10min can decreased the incidence of agitation during the recovery period of children.
